LG V20, The First Android 7.0 Nougat Laden Smartphone Announced


South Korean electronics giant LG Electronics earlier today announced the launch of its new Android-powered smartphone, the LG V20 at an event. The handset, as evident by its naming scheme, is a successor to the LG V10 that the company had launched last year. For the same reason, the LG V20 does inherit some of the qualities of the V10 – including the sturdy build, great camera, and not to mention, the capability to playback audiophile-grade audio. The LG V20 is also the first phone to officially launch with Android 7.0 Nougat – an honor that is usually bestowed to Google’s Nexus series of devices.

While the LG V20 does heavily borrow its features from the V10, design-wise, it is closer in design to LG’s current flagship device, the LG G5. That said, the V20 does not get the G5’s modular capabilities.

Let us check out the spec-sheet of the LG V20 now.

Being a high-end handset, the LG V20 is powered by the powerful Qualcomm Snapdragon 820 processor that has been around for a while now. There is 4 GB of RAM and 64 GB of internal storage that can be expanded further if you wish to, using microSD cards. The phone features a 5.7-inch QHD IPS Quantum Display with a resolution of 2560 x 1440 pixels, thereby offering a PPI density of around 513. Apart from this, the phone also gets a secondary display that has a resolution of 160 x 1040 pixels.

While we did talk about the imaging bit briefly in the introduction, here are the details. The LG V20 gets twin cameras at the rear with the main unit being a 16-megapixel primary camera with F1.8 Aperture and support for Optical Image Stabilization (Standard Angle). Apart from this, there is an 8-megapixel F2.4 secondary camera with a wide angle lens. The third camera on the LG V20 is at the front – this one being a 5-megapixel camera, again with a wide angle lens and an F1.9 aperture promising great selfies. The phone is also capable of high-quality video recording and can capture videos in 4K resolution with OIS.

The LG V20 will sport a large 3,200 mAh battery that the company claims will provide ample juice to last an entire day. However, it does fall short of the capacities offered by competing devices. As expected of a device in its class, the LG V20 does get Quick Charge 3.0-compatible through its USB-C jack. Also note that unlike most handsets in its class, the battery on the LG V20 is removable. This, however, does mean that the V20 does not get any kind of water resistance abilities.

Another key element of the LG V20 is its audio playback capabilities, The phone features a dedicated 32-bit quad DAC setup that promises audiophile grade audio quality. LG has tied up with Bang & Olufsen who helped them helped fine tune the playback performance on the LG V20. As expected, the phone supports all the popular lossless music formats including Apple Lossless and boats of a 72-stage volume control. The LG V20 also gets a high-quality microphone that the company claims is capable of recording without distortion even in loud environments. What’s more, you can save the recorded audio in a lossless format for the highest quality possible. The Bang & Olufsen collaboration also means that the phone would come bundled with a special B&O Play H3 earphones in select markets.

LG V20 Specifications:

  • Chipset: Qualcomm Snapdragon 820 Processor
  • Display: Main 5.7-inch QHD IPS Quantum Display (2560 x 1440 / 513ppi) /Secondary IPS Quantum Display
  • Memory: 4GB LPDDR4 RAM / 64GB UFS ROM / microSD (up to 2TB)
  • Camera: Front 5MP with F1.9 Aperture (Wide Angle) / Rear 16MP with F1.8 Aperture OIS (Standard Angle) and 8MP with F2.4 Aperture (Wide Angle)
  • Battery: 3200mAh (removable)
  • Operating System: Android 7.0 Nougat
  • Size: 159.7 x 78.1 x 7.6mm
  • Network: LTE-A 3 Band CA
  • Connectivity: X12 LTE (up to 600 Mbps LTE Category 12 with 3x Carrier Aggregation) / Wi-Fi (802.11 a, b, g, n, ac) / USB Type-C / Bluetooth 4.2 BLE / NFC
  • Colors: Titan / Silver / Pink
  • Other features: Hi-Fi Video Recording / Steady Record 2.0 / HD Audio Recorder / Studio Mode / High AOP Mic / Second Screen / 32-bit Hi-Fi Quad DAC / In Apps / B&O Collaboration / Finger Print Scanner / Qualcomm Quick Charge 3.0

LG is yet to announce an official launch date for the LG V20. Pricing details too have not been revealed.
